Ticket VLT-providence: locked vault blocking EXIF scrubbing review. The Scrublight pipeline strips EXIF metadata from uploaded images before they reach the Marrowdale CDN, and the test corpus of tagged sample images lives in the Providence vault. The vault auto-locked after the quarterly rotation, so reviewers cannot pull the corpus to verify the new GPS-tag removal path. Until the rotation tooling is fixed, reviewers should unlock the vault manually using the recovery passphrase, which I am recording here for the review window.

strongbox words: istwyn-normir-silwyn-ulaius-istwyn

### Digestor v1.9.0 — Scheduled Key Rotation

This release rotates the signing key used by the Digestor batch scheduler, which signs each nightly email-digest manifest before workers pick it up. Reviewers should note: the rotation is dual-keyed for one release cycle, so manifests signed with the outgoing key remain valid until v2.0. Verification logic in `manifest_check` now iterates an ordered keyset rather than a single pinned value — please review that diff closely. For audit purposes, the incoming signing key is recorded here.

release key, yagap-kagag: bky6_1ks93y

Internal Memo — Gross-Margin Review

Welcome aboard! Quick primer before your first leadership sync: we just wrapped the annual gross-margin review at Dovenport Goods. Short story — the Calloway line is healthy, the Brixton range is underwater after freight increases, and pricing hasn't kept pace. Finance wants a corrective plan within thirty days, and you'll own it. To get you oriented, the confidential note on our plans is included just below.

internal memo for hahif-hahaf: Headcount on the Zorwyn team goes from 9 to 100 by the end of October. Gross margin on Zorwyn came in at 5 percent against a plan of 10 percent.